The Evolution of Baseball’s Pace of Play
Baseball has always been a game steeped in tradition, with an unwritten set of rules that dictate the rhythm of play. However, as society evolves, the demand for faster-paced sports has become more prevalent. This section explores how the pace of play has changed over time and the implications this has for fans and players alike.
Historical Context of Game Duration
The duration of a baseball game has fluctuated since its inception. In the early 1900s, games often lasted around two hours.
As the years went by, various factors contributed to longer game times, including increased commercial breaks and pitching changes.
Fans began to notice this trend, often feeling frustrated by the drawn-out nature of contemporary matches.
The Rise of the Pitch Clock
In recent years, Major League Baseball (MLB) has introduced a pitch clock to address the growing concerns regarding game length.
The pitch clock counts down the seconds between pitches, requiring pitchers to deliver the ball within a specified timeframe.
While some argue that this enhances the viewing experience, others believe it undermines the very essence of the game.
Fan Reactions to Time Constraints
Fan reactions have been mixed, with some embracing the change while others decry it as an affront to baseball traditions.
Those who favor the pitch clock argue that it keeps fans engaged and encourages offensive plays.
Conversely, detractors claim that the imposition of a timer disrupts the flow of the game and diminishes the strategic elements that define it.

The Debate: Pros and Cons of the Pitch Clock
The introduction of the pitch clock has sparked intense debate among fans, players, and analysts alike.
Exploring both sides of the argument reveals the complexities surrounding rule changes in professional sports.
Advantages of Implementing a Pitch Clock
Proponents of the pitch clock emphasize several benefits that this change brings to the game:
- Enhanced Viewer Experience: By shortening game durations, viewers spend less time waiting and more time enjoying the action.
- Encouraged Aggressive Play: The pressure of the clock pushes pitchers to work faster, which can lead to more dynamic gameplay.
- Appeal to Younger Audiences: Modern audiences are accustomed to faster entertainment, making baseball more accessible to younger fans.
Disadvantages of the Pitch Clock
On the flip side, critics raise valid concerns about the implications of implementing a pitch clock:
- Loss of Strategic Depth: Baseball is a game of strategy, and the pitch clock may rush decisions that should be carefully considered.
- Potentially Unfair Penalization: The threat of penalties for exceeding the time limit can create tension and disrupt a player’s routine.
- Cultural Shift: Many traditionalists view the pitch clock as a radical departure from beloved customs, altering the fabric of baseball itself.
Finding Common Ground
Though passionate debates abound, exploring solutions that appeal to both sides can foster understanding and promote innovation in the sport.
Some fans propose a compromise—tailoring the pitch clock to specific situations rather than applying it universally.
Others advocate for gradual implementation, allowing players and fans alike to adjust to the changes without sacrificing the sport’s authenticity.
